首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将大型.sql文件导入MySQL时出错

可能是由于以下原因导致的:

  1. 文件大小限制:MySQL服务器可能有文件大小限制,如果导入的.sql文件超过了服务器设置的最大文件大小限制,导入过程会出错。解决方法是修改MySQL服务器的配置文件,增加max_allowed_packet参数的值,以支持更大的文件导入。
  2. 内存不足:导入大型.sql文件时,MySQL服务器需要足够的内存来处理导入操作。如果服务器的内存不足,导入过程可能会失败。解决方法是增加服务器的内存或者使用分批导入的方式,将大文件分成多个较小的.sql文件进行导入。
  3. 数据库权限问题:导入.sql文件需要具有足够的权限才能执行。确保使用的MySQL用户具有足够的权限来执行导入操作。
  4. 数据库版本不兼容:如果导入的.sql文件是从一个较新版本的MySQL导出的,而目标MySQL服务器的版本较旧,可能会导致导入失败。解决方法是升级目标MySQL服务器的版本,以支持导入文件中使用的新特性。
  5. 文件编码问题:如果导入的.sql文件使用了不同于目标MySQL服务器的字符编码,可能会导致导入失败。确保导入文件的字符编码与目标MySQL服务器的字符编码一致。

对于解决这个问题,腾讯云提供了一系列的产品和服务来支持云计算和数据库相关的需求:

  1. 云服务器(CVM):提供可扩展的计算资源,用于部署和运行MySQL服务器。
  2. 云数据库MySQL版(TencentDB for MySQL):提供高可用、可扩展的MySQL数据库服务,支持自动备份、容灾、性能优化等功能。
  3. 云数据库灾备版(TencentDB for DRDS):提供分布式关系型数据库服务,支持大规模数据存储和查询。
  4. 云数据库数据传输服务(Data Transmission Service,DTS):提供数据迁移和同步服务,可用于将大型.sql文件导入到MySQL数据库中。
  5. 云监控(Cloud Monitor):提供实时监控和告警功能,可用于监控MySQL服务器的性能和状态。
  6. 云安全中心(Cloud Security Center):提供安全评估和威胁检测服务,可用于保护MySQL服务器免受安全威胁。

以上是腾讯云提供的一些相关产品和服务,可以帮助解决大型.sql文件导入MySQL时出错的问题。具体的产品介绍和详细信息,请参考腾讯云官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分5秒

SQLite文件stores.db导入mysql workbench中出错

2分29秒

MySQL系列七之任务1【导入SQL文件,生成表格数据】

4分11秒

05、mysql系列之命令、快捷窗口的使用

7分5秒

MySQL数据闪回工具reverse_sql

2分37秒

Golang 开源 Excelize 基础库教程 1.1 Excelize 简介

3.1K
7分25秒

Golang 开源 Excelize 基础库教程 1.2 Go 语言开发环境搭建与安装

2K
11分37秒

Golang 开源 Excelize 基础库教程 2.1 单元格赋值、样式设置与图片图表的综合应用

390
13分24秒

Golang 开源 Excelize 基础库教程 2.3 CSV 转 XLSX、行高列宽和富文本设置

1.5K
9分1秒

Golang 开源 Excelize 基础库教程 2.5 迷你图、页眉页脚、隐藏与保护工作表

357
7分34秒

Golang 开源 Excelize 基础库教程 3.1 流式生成包含大规模数据的电子表格文档

2.1K
9分33秒

Golang 开源 Excelize 基础库教程 1.3 基本概念

1.3K
6分12秒

Golang 开源 Excelize 基础库教程 2.2 条件格式、批注和数据验证设置

396
领券